1. What Is IPTV Live Football And How Does It Work?

IPTV live football refers to watching live football matches through Internet Protocol Television (IPTV). This technology delivers television content over an IP network, rather than through traditional broadcast, satellite, or cable formats. IPTV live football streams work by converting the football match broadcast into a digital format that can be transmitted over the internet. Your device, such as a smart TV, computer, or mobile device, receives this data stream and decodes it to display the live football game.

  • Content Delivery: The live football content is delivered via a broadband connection.
  • Data Transmission: The digital data packets are transmitted to the user’s device.
  • Decoding: The device decodes the data to display the football match in real-time.

2.1 How can you evaluate the quality of an IPTV provider?

Evaluating the quality of an IPTV provider involves assessing several factors. Streaming quality is crucial; look for providers that offer high-definition (HD) or even 4K streams. Reliability is also important, ensuring minimal buffering or downtime during live matches. Channel selection should include all the major football leagues and competitions you’re interested in. Customer support should be responsive and helpful in case you encounter any issues.

  • Streaming Quality: Look for HD or 4K streams.
  • Reliability: Ensure minimal buffering and downtime.
  • Channel Selection: Comprehensive coverage of desired football leagues.
  • Customer Support: Responsive and helpful assistance.

2.2 What are the potential risks of using unofficial IPTV services?

Using unofficial IPTV services for live football can expose you to several risks. These services often provide unstable streams, leading to frequent interruptions and poor viewing experiences. The video quality may be subpar, with low resolution and pixelation. Additionally, using unofficial services can pose legal risks, as they often infringe on copyright laws. There is also a higher risk of exposure to malware and viruses when using unverified sources.

  • Unstable Streams: Frequent interruptions and buffering.
  • Poor Video Quality: Low resolution and pixelation.
  • Legal Risks: Copyright infringement issues.
  • Malware and Viruses: Higher risk of exposure from unverified sources.

3.1 What are the best IPTV players for different devices?

Several IPTV players are available for different devices. For smart TVs and Android devices, TiviMate and Perfect Player are popular choices due to their user-friendly interfaces and extensive customization options. For computers, VLC Media Player is a versatile option that supports various streaming protocols. On iOS devices, GSE Smart IPTV is a reliable choice with good streaming quality.

  • Smart TVs/Android: TiviMate, Perfect Player.
  • Computers: VLC Media Player.
  • iOS Devices: GSE Smart IPTV.

3.2 What settings should you configure for optimal viewing?

To optimize your IPTV viewing experience, configure the following settings: Video resolution should be set to the highest possible quality your device and internet connection can support. Buffering settings can be adjusted to reduce interruptions, though this may require a faster internet speed. EPG (Electronic Program Guide) settings should be configured to display accurate and up-to-date program information.

  • Video Resolution: Set to the highest supported quality.
  • Buffering Settings: Adjust to reduce interruptions.
  • EPG Settings: Configure for accurate program information.

4. How Can You Improve Your IPTV Streaming Quality For Live Football?

Improving IPTV streaming quality for live football involves several strategies. Ensure you have a stable and fast internet connection. A wired Ethernet connection is generally more reliable than Wi-Fi. Close any unnecessary applications or devices using your internet connection to free up bandwidth. Adjust the video resolution in your IPTV player to match your internet speed; lower resolutions require less bandwidth.

  • Stable Internet Connection: Use a wired Ethernet connection if possible.
  • Close Unnecessary Applications: Free up bandwidth by closing unused apps.
  • Adjust Video Resolution: Lower resolution to match internet speed.

4.1 What internet speed do you need for streaming live football in HD?

To stream live football in HD, you generally need an internet speed of at least 5-10 Mbps. For 4K streaming, a speed of 25 Mbps or higher is recommended. Keep in mind that these are minimum requirements, and other devices using the same internet connection can impact streaming quality.

  • HD Streaming: 5-10 Mbps.
  • 4K Streaming: 25 Mbps or higher.

4.2 How can you troubleshoot common IPTV streaming issues?

Common IPTV streaming issues can often be resolved with simple troubleshooting steps. If you experience buffering, try restarting your router and modem. Ensure your IPTV app or player is up to date. Check the IPTV server status with your provider to see if there are any known issues. If the problem persists, contact your IPTV provider for technical support.

  • Restart Router and Modem: Reset your network connection.
  • Update IPTV App/Player: Ensure you have the latest version.
  • Check IPTV Server Status: Verify if there are provider-side issues.
  • Contact Technical Support: Seek assistance from your IPTV provider.

5. Are There Legal Alternatives To IPTV For Watching Live Football?

Yes, there are several legal alternatives to IPTV for watching live football. Streaming services like ESPN+, Peacock, and Paramount+ offer live football coverage as part of their subscription packages. Cable and satellite providers often have sports packages that include major football leagues. Additionally, some official league streaming services, like NFL Game Pass or MLS Season Pass, provide access to specific football content.

  • ESPN+: Offers a variety of live sports, including football.
  • Peacock: Streams select Premier League matches and other sports content.
  • Paramount+: Provides live coverage of UEFA Champions League and other football competitions.
  • NFL Game Pass: Offers access to NFL games and content.
  • MLS Season Pass: Streams Major League Soccer matches.

6.1 How can you find channels that broadcast specific football matches?

To find channels that broadcast specific football matches on IPTV, use the EPG (Electronic Program Guide) provided by your IPTV service. The EPG lists the channels and their schedules, allowing you to find the matches you want to watch. You can also use third-party sports schedule websites or apps to identify which channels are broadcasting specific games and then locate those channels on your IPTV service.

  • EPG (Electronic Program Guide): Use the built-in guide on your IPTV service.
  • Third-Party Sports Schedule Websites/Apps: Identify channels broadcasting specific games.

6.2 Are there regional restrictions on which leagues you can watch?

Yes, regional restrictions can affect which football leagues and competitions you can watch on IPTV. Some IPTV providers may block access to certain channels or leagues based on your geographic location due to licensing agreements. Using a VPN (Virtual Private Network) can sometimes bypass these restrictions, but it’s essential to check the legality of using a VPN with your IPTV service in your region.

  • Licensing Agreements: Providers may block content based on geographic location.
  • VPN (Virtual Private Network): Can sometimes bypass restrictions.

7.1 What are some useful features in IPTV players for football fans?

Several features in IPTV players are particularly useful for football fans. Multi-screen viewing allows you to watch multiple games simultaneously. Catch-up TV lets you watch matches that have already aired. EPG (Electronic Program Guide) provides a schedule of upcoming games. Recording capabilities enable you to save matches for later viewing.

  • Multi-Screen Viewing: Watch multiple games simultaneously.
  • Catch-Up TV: Watch previously aired matches.
  • EPG (Electronic Program Guide): Schedule of upcoming games.
  • Recording Capabilities: Save matches for later viewing.
